Output 34a6f9865fdb6e053c4f6290b46ff9a7e0c21f57762e4f19b31adc0ce653a955:0

value
102671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0d6f220c03e9aa051c96f90d29d96758106e1f OP_EQUAL
address
3L7NWiFbaSvcn4MfdxmVvAncfqzgfz3yhR
transaction
34a6f9865fdb6e053c4f6290b46ff9a7e0c21f57762e4f19b31adc0ce653a955
spent
true